11Handbombs are thrown alchemy items in Fatekeeper. They are produced through the same three-ingredient system as potions and weapon vials, but their delivery is a thrown projectile rather than a swallowed liquid or a weapon coating. Handbombs are the Druid's primary tool for opening encounters with damage, breaking up grouped enemies, and applying area status effects.2233Use Cases445566Open encounters. The build that throws handbombs in volume.151516+The Named Throwables17+18+Three named bombs appear in the 0.1.3 files, along with two other items that are thrown or placed rather than brewed. All three bombs sit at Common rarity, which suggests the family is meant to be a routine crafting output rather than a rare find.19+20+ItemTypeRarityWhat It IsExplosive BombThrowableCommonThe baseline damage bombShrapnel BombThrowableCommonFragmentation variant, the group-clearing optionVirulent Gas BombThrowableCommonApplies a lingering area effect rather than burst damageBoomweedTrapCommonPlaced rather than thrown, a set-and-lure optionCorpseThrowableCommonA body can be picked up and thrown, which is a physics interaction rather than an alchemy output21+Boomweed is the interesting one: it is the only placeable trap in the files, so a Druid can prepare ground before a fight rather than only reacting once it starts. And the fact that a corpse counts as a throwable at all is a reminder that the physics layer and the alchemy layer overlap.22+23+The roster below is compiled from the 0.1.3 game files by the player community. Paraglacial has not published an item list, so treat exact numbers as approximate and expect them to move between patches; the names themselves are stable and several of them appear verbatim in shipped change logs.24+1625Open Questions17261827Throw range, fuse timing, blast radius, and whether bombs can ricochet or stick are unconfirmed.
